PIGGY6 HomePlug Power Strip – ugly duckling networking box spreads networking love

Piggy6homeplugethernet

This  PIGGY6 HomePlug Power Strip gets our vote as the ugliest product of the month, all clunky black plastic and orifices, but it’s actually a pretty useful bit of kit. The thing comes with 3 ethernet ports built in, plus a filtered powerline networking module, so you can plug it in to your home’s electrical system, hook up your games consoles, computers and what have you, and enjoy wire-free networking in any room in the house. The multiple power sockets may be unconventionally arranged, but it makes for a more compact unit really. £72.10.

 The VeseNET HomePlug Mains Power Strip with 3 Ethernet Ports operates on the HomePlug Powerline AV Specification standard, providing up to 200Mbps bandwidth over home AC wiring. Since the home power lines are the most pervasive medium in households with multiple outlets in every room, the PIGGY6 HomePlug Power Strip allows multiple home gaming consoles, AV devices, desktops computers, and notebooks to be networked, to share Internet, printers, files, and play games without any additional wiring.
